--- a/configure Sun Jun 22 06:49:00 2008 +0000 +++ b/configure Sun Jun 22 08:59:39 2008 +0000 @@ -7774,6 +7774,7 @@ HAVE_OSMESA='yes' + VIDEO_DRIVERS="$VIDEO_DRIVERS osmesa" cat >>confdefs.h <<\_ACEOF #define HAVE_OSMESA 1 @@ -8093,6 +8094,7 @@ if test $ac_cv_func_NSOpenGLGetVersion = yes; then HAVE_NSGL='yes' + VIDEO_DRIVERS="$VIDEO_DRIVERS nsgl" cat >>confdefs.h <<\_ACEOF #define HAVE_NSGL 1 @@ -8194,6 +8196,7 @@ if test $ac_cv_func_glXQueryVersion = yes; then HAVE_GLX='yes' + VIDEO_DRIVERS="$VIDEO_DRIVERS glx" cat >>confdefs.h <<\_ACEOF #define HAVE_GLX 1 @@ -8208,9 +8211,6 @@ -if test "x$HAVE_OSMESA" = "x" -a "x$HAVE_GLX" = "x" -a "x$HAVE_NSGL" = "x"; then - echo "Warning: Building with no video support" -fi @@ -8625,8 +8625,6 @@ #define SH4_TRANSLATOR TARGET_X86 _ACEOF ;; - *) - echo "Warning: No translator available for $host. Building emulation core only";; esac @@ -8649,26 +8647,26 @@ fi -if test "${ac_cv_header_AudioToolbox_AudioToolbox_h+set}" = set; then - { $as_echo "$as_me:$LINENO: checking for AudioToolbox/AudioToolbox.h" >&5 -$as_echo_n "checking for AudioToolbox/AudioToolbox.h... " >&6; } -if test "${ac_cv_header_AudioToolbox_AudioToolbox_h+set}" = set; then - $as_echo_n "(cached) " >&6 -fi -{ $as_echo "$as_me:$LINENO: result: $ac_cv_header_AudioToolbox_AudioToolbox_h" >&5 -$as_echo "$ac_cv_header_AudioToolbox_AudioToolbox_h" >&6; } +if test "${ac_cv_header_CoreAudio_CoreAudio_h+set}" = set; then + { $as_echo "$as_me:$LINENO: checking for CoreAudio/CoreAudio.h" >&5 +$as_echo_n "checking for CoreAudio/CoreAudio.h... " >&6; } +if test "${ac_cv_header_CoreAudio_CoreAudio_h+set}" = set; then + $as_echo_n "(cached) " >&6 +fi +{ $as_echo "$as_me:$LINENO: result: $ac_cv_header_CoreAudio_CoreAudio_h" >&5 +$as_echo "$ac_cv_header_CoreAudio_CoreAudio_h" >&6; } else # Is the header compilable? -{ $as_echo "$as_me:$LINENO: checking AudioToolbox/AudioToolbox.h usability" >&5 -$as_echo_n "checking AudioToolbox/AudioToolbox.h usability... " >&6; } -cat >conftest.$ac_ext <<_ACEOF -/* confdefs.h. */ -_ACEOF -cat confdefs.h >>conftest.$ac_ext -cat >>conftest.$ac_ext <<_ACEOF -/* end confdefs.h. */ -$ac_includes_default -#include +{ $as_echo "$as_me:$LINENO: checking CoreAudio/CoreAudio.h usability" >&5 +$as_echo_n "checking CoreAudio/CoreAudio.h usability... " >&6; } +cat >conftest.$ac_ext <<_ACEOF +/* confdefs.h. */ +_ACEOF +cat confdefs.h >>conftest.$ac_ext +cat >>conftest.$ac_ext <<_ACEOF +/* end confdefs.h. */ +$ac_includes_default +#include _ACEOF rm -f conftest.$ac_objext if { (ac_try="$ac_compile" @@ -8701,15 +8699,15 @@ $as_echo "$ac_header_compiler" >&6; } # Is the header present? -{ $as_echo "$as_me:$LINENO: checking AudioToolbox/AudioToolbox.h presence" >&5 -$as_echo_n "checking AudioToolbox/AudioToolbox.h presence... " >&6; } -cat >conftest.$ac_ext <<_ACEOF -/* confdefs.h. */ -_ACEOF -cat confdefs.h >>conftest.$ac_ext -cat >>conftest.$ac_ext <<_ACEOF -/* end confdefs.h. */ -#include +{ $as_echo "$as_me:$LINENO: checking CoreAudio/CoreAudio.h presence" >&5 +$as_echo_n "checking CoreAudio/CoreAudio.h presence... " >&6; } +cat >conftest.$ac_ext <<_ACEOF +/* confdefs.h. */ +_ACEOF +cat confdefs.h >>conftest.$ac_ext +cat >>conftest.$ac_ext <<_ACEOF +/* end confdefs.h. */ +#include _ACEOF if { (ac_try="$ac_cpp conftest.$ac_ext" case "(($ac_try" in @@ -8743,43 +8741,44 @@ # So? What about this header? case $ac_header_compiler:$ac_header_preproc:$ac_c_preproc_warn_flag in yes:no: ) -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: accepted by the compiler, rejected by the preprocessor!"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: accepted by the compiler, rejected by the preprocessor!"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: proceeding with the compiler's result"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: proceeding with the compiler's result"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: accepted by the compiler, rejected by the preprocessor!"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: accepted by the compiler, rejected by the preprocessor!"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: proceeding with the compiler's result"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: proceeding with the compiler's result" >&2;} ac_header_preproc=yes ;; no:yes:* ) -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: present but cannot be compiled"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: present but cannot be compiled"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: check for missing prerequisite headers?"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: check for missing prerequisite headers?"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: see the Autoconf documentation"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: see the Autoconf documentation"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: section \"Present But Cannot Be Compiled\""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: section \"Present But Cannot Be Compiled\""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: proceeding with the preprocessor's result"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: proceeding with the preprocessor's result" >&2;} - { $as_echo "$as_me:$LINENO: WARNING: AudioToolbox/AudioToolbox.h: in the future, the compiler will take precedence" >&5 -$as_echo "$as_me: WARNING: AudioToolbox/AudioToolbox.h: in the future, the compiler will take precedence" >&2;} - - ;; -esac -{ $as_echo "$as_me:$LINENO: checking for AudioToolbox/AudioToolbox.h" >&5 -$as_echo_n "checking for AudioToolbox/AudioToolbox.h... " >&6; } -if test "${ac_cv_header_AudioToolbox_AudioToolbox_h+set}" = set; then - $as_echo_n "(cached) " >&6 -else - ac_cv_header_AudioToolbox_AudioToolbox_h=$ac_header_preproc -fi -{ $as_echo "$as_me:$LINENO: result: $ac_cv_header_AudioToolbox_AudioToolbox_h" >&5 -$as_echo "$ac_cv_header_AudioToolbox_AudioToolbox_h" >&6; } - -fi -if test $ac_cv_header_AudioToolbox_AudioToolbox_h = yes; then +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: present but cannot be compiled"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: present but cannot be compiled"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: check for missing prerequisite headers?"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: check for missing prerequisite headers?"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: see the Autoconf documentation"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: see the Autoconf documentation"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: section \"Present But Cannot Be Compiled\""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: section \"Present But Cannot Be Compiled\""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: proceeding with the preprocessor's result"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: proceeding with the preprocessor's result" >&2;} + { $as_echo "$as_me:$LINENO: WARNING: CoreAudio/CoreAudio.h: in the future, the compiler will take precedence" >&5 +$as_echo "$as_me: WARNING: CoreAudio/CoreAudio.h: in the future, the compiler will take precedence" >&2;} + + ;; +esac +{ $as_echo "$as_me:$LINENO: checking for CoreAudio/CoreAudio.h" >&5 +$as_echo_n "checking for CoreAudio/CoreAudio.h... " >&6; } +if test "${ac_cv_header_CoreAudio_CoreAudio_h+set}" = set; then + $as_echo_n "(cached) " >&6 +else + ac_cv_header_CoreAudio_CoreAudio_h=$ac_header_preproc +fi +{ $as_echo "$as_me:$LINENO: result: $ac_cv_header_CoreAudio_CoreAudio_h" >&5 +$as_echo "$ac_cv_header_CoreAudio_CoreAudio_h" >&6; } + +fi +if test $ac_cv_header_CoreAudio_CoreAudio_h = yes; then HAVE_CORE_AUDIO=yes - LIBS="$LIBS -framework AudioToolbox -framework AudioUnit" + LIBS="$LIBS -framework CoreAudio" + AUDIO_DRIVERS="$AUDIO_DRIVERS osx" cat >>confdefs.h <<\_ACEOF #define HAVE_CORE_AUDIO 1 @@ -8872,6 +8871,7 @@ $as_echo "yes" >&6; } HAVE_PULSE='yes' + AUDIO_DRIVERS="$AUDIO_DRIVERS pulse" cat >>confdefs.h <<\_ACEOF #define HAVE_PULSE 1 @@ -8960,6 +8960,7 @@ $as_echo "yes" >&6; } HAVE_ESOUND='yes' + AUDIO_DRIVERS="$AUDIO_DRIVERS esd" cat >>confdefs.h <<\_ACEOF #define HAVE_ESOUND 1 @@ -9048,6 +9049,7 @@ $as_echo "yes" >&6; } HAVE_ALSA='yes' + AUDIO_DRIVERS="$AUDIO_DRIVERS alsa" cat >>confdefs.h <<\_ACEOF #define HAVE_ALSA 1 @@ -9065,9 +9067,6 @@ fi -if test "x$HAVE_ESOUND" = "x" -a "x$HAVE_ALSA" = "x" -a "x$HAVE_PULSE" = "x"; then - echo "Warning: Building without audio support" -fi if test "${ac_cv_header_linux_cdrom_h+set}" = set; then { $as_echo "$as_me:$LINENO: checking for linux/cdrom.h" >&5 @@ -12790,3 +12789,36 @@ fi + +echo +echo "Configuration complete" +echo + +if test "x$HAVE_GTK" = x; then + if test "x$HAVE_COCOA" = x; then + echo " User interface: none" + else + echo " User interface: Cocoa" + fi +else + echo " User interface: GTK" +fi + +if test "x$SH4_TRANSLATOR" = "x"; then + echo " SH4 translator: None (emulation core only)" +else + echo " SH4 translator: $SH4_TRANSLATOR" +fi + +if test "x$VIDEO_DRIVERS" = "x"; then + echo " Video drivers: none (no supported GL found)" +else + echo " Video drivers: $VIDEO_DRIVERS" +fi + +if test "x$AUDIO_DRIVERS" = "x"; then + echo " Audio drivers: none (no supported output devices found)" +else + echo " Audio drivers: $AUDIO_DRIVERS" +fi +